Peripheral endothelin B receptor agonist-induced antinociception involves endogenous opioids in mice
Endothelin-1 (ET-1) produced by various cancers is known to be responsible for inducing pain. While ET-1 binding to ETAR on peripheral nerves clearly mediates nociception, effects from binding to ETBR are less clear.
